Alternative Frac Waters And GasFrac Canada

By Joshua Cole


Hydraulic fracturing has faced a great deal of criticism. In most cases, the criticism is due to the already existing shortage of clean water on earth. While some companies like GasFrac Canada are now using alternative frac waters, others need to do so. Although, excessive water use is not the only issue, drilling deep into the rock formation of earth has proved to be the cause of man-made earthquakes in different areas including, Texas and Oklahoma.

Regardless of these concerns, GasFrac has made progress by using petroleum based liquids which can be injected into the earth instead of using water based chemical cocktails. In the process, a great deal of risk with regards to water table contamination is eliminated. While this is the case, the issue of man-made seismic activity still needs to be addressed.

While GasFrac uses propane as a liquid, there are other alternatives, though propane does appear to be the most popular substitute for water.

The benefits in using propane all result from the chemical aspects of propane compared to that of water. Such benefits include that fracking operations are more effective when using propane because of the reversal of liquid propane to a gas form. As a result of the pressure and heat in the well, oil and gas flow more freely back to the surface, thus eliminating blockages which often occur when water becomes trapped below the surface.

Water-free fracking also helps to prevent pollutants from escaping to the surface. For, when a liquid version of propane vaporizes, the pollutants are left in the well. Whereas, operations which use water tend to carry these pollutants back to the surface, including chemicals used in the process and heavy metals which are a natural aspect of the rock formations which have been disturbed.

One of the biggest benefits in using liquid propane is that once used, the substance can be recycled or sold for profit. Whereas, when companies consider the cost associated with disposing polluted frac water, waterless fracking can often be a better option.
